Company Overview

Cargojet Inc operates a domestic air cargo co-load network between sixteen major Canadian cities. The company provides dedicated aircraft to customers on an Aircraft, Crew, Maintenance and Insurance basis, operating between points in Canada, USA, Mexico and Europe. The company also operates scheduled international routes for multiple cargo customers between the USA and Bermuda, between Canada, UK and Germany; and between Canada and Mexico.

Cargojet Inc. (TSE:CJT) announced its quarterly earnings results on Monday, November, 4th. The company reported $1.48 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$1.14 by $0.34. Cargojet had a net margin of 0.25% and a trailing twelve-month return on equity of 0.31%.
